Intelligent Process Automation (IPA) is an advanced form of automation that integrates art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and robotic process automation (RPA) to enhance business processes. IPA goes beyond simple task automation by introducing smart decision-making and adaptability to changing conditions. It combines the power of technology to perform repetitive tasks with the ability to learn, predict, and optimize based on data insights. This results in more efficient, error-free operations, faster decision-making, and improved customer experiences.
Key Components of Intelligent Process Automation
- Robotic Process Automation (RPA): RPA refers to the use of software robots to automate structured, rule-based tasks, such as data entry or invoicing. RPA is the backbone of IPA, performing the basic automation functions.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ML): AI and ML allow the system to make decisions based on patterns, learn from data, and adapt over time. These technologies enhance IPA’s capabilities, enabling it to handle more complex tasks that require judgment and foresight.
- Data Analytics and Insights: IPA uses data analytics to gather insights that drive intelligent decision-making. By analyzing historical and real-time data, IPA can anticipate trends, improve process outcomes, and enhance business strategies.

Applications of Intelligent Process Automation
- Customer Service: IPA-driven chatbots and virtual assistants help businesses handle routine customer queries and resolve issues quickly, reducing wait times and enhancing customer satisfaction.
- Human Resources: Automation of HR processes such as recruitment, onboarding, payroll processing, and compliance tracking allows HR teams to focus on employee engagement and strategic initiatives.
- Finance and Accounting: IPA optimizes financial workflows like invoicing, audits, and financial reporting, reducing errors and increasing speed. Automated reconciliation and fraud detection are also key applications in the financial sector.
- Supply Chain Management: IPA enhances supply chain operations by automating inventory management, order processing, demand forecasting, and logistics coordination. It ensures faster, more efficient supply chain activities with fewer disruptions.
